For a start our children are a little older at 13, 11 and nearly 9 but usually the CL's we use have plenty of space. Provided Children are reasonably behaved and do not play by other units you would have no issues. The CL we use in North Devon, the owner gives them free run of the yard and her garden, even laying on an easter egg hunt for them, One in North Yorkshire there's a huge expance of space for them as well as acres of forest to explore. In Hampshire again plenty of space and Derbyshire and East yorks. We tend to stick to CL's without electrics or facilities although location normally comes first. Dartmouth last August cost us £5 per night, again a big field with plenty of play space. Owner of a CL we used near penzance this year said how nice it was to have a family for a change and not just another couple.
Having a look on google maps etc before booking to get a view of the field size and location works well as well just checking in the book at the size of the field. We would avoid ones that were only say a quater of an acre.
